- The distance between Conakry, Guinea and Bayandelger, Mongolia is approximately 11,851 km or 7,365 mi.
- To reach Conakry in this distance one would set out from Bayandelger bearing 303.6°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Conakry bearing 216.1° or SW .
- Conakry has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am) whereas Bayandelger has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k).
- Conakry is in or near the tropical wet forest biome whereas Bayandelger is in or near the boreal moist for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 25 °C (44.9°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 37.6 °C (67.7°F) less in Conakry.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 3587.7 mm (141.2 in) more which is equivalent to 3587.7 l/m² (88.05 US gal/ft²) or 35,877,000 l/ha (3,835,489 US gal/ac) more. About 19 2/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 29.4° higher in Conakry than in Bayandelger.
